Huff to comment live from the cockpit
A first for the series
The reigning WTCC Champion, Rob Huff, will comment live on TV from his car this weekend, during the FIA World Touring Car Championship meeting at the Salzburgring in Austria.
It’s planned that the live feed from Rob’s camera will be featured during the formation lap and in any safety car period during the races themselves.
In a first for the series, live audio from the driver will be available as well as the traditional live video feeds that make the WTCC so exciting for television viewers.
Rob, driving one of the Münnich Motorsport SEAT León cars, will be able to describe the circuit to viewers as he completes the formation lap, while he will be able to give his reaction to any incidents that bring out the safety car.
